Dredging start date will be more like mid-September than early September, so after the Labor day holiday; the dredge pipeline is still scheduled to be placed above ground cutting off pathway access between the harbor and Mason Avenue, but other options including burial are still being considered; USACE advises all questions and requests for public information go through the public information officer not the project manager.
The harbormaster and Planner are working on an informational flyer for the boaters, which should be ready next week.
